Power Line Chokes
Current-Compensated Ring Core Double Chokes
B82791-H/G
Rated voltage 250 V~
Rated current 0,25 to 0,7 A
Rated inductance 4,7 bis 47 mH
Construction
q
Current-compensated ring core double choke
with ferrite core
q
Polycarbonate case
q
Without potting
q
Sector winding
Vertical version
Features
q
Vertical and horizontal versions
q
Case flame-retardant as per UL 94 V-0
q
High resonant frequency owing to special winding
technique and no potting compound
q
Approx. 1 % stray inductance for symmetrical
interference suppression
